Class SelectRowCheckbox.ChildCheckbox
java.lang.Object
javax.faces.component.UIComponent
javax.faces.component.UIComponentBase
com.webmethods.caf.faces.component.BaseComponent
com.webmethods.caf.faces.component.table.SelectRow
com.webmethods.caf.faces.component.table.SelectRowIndividualCheckbox
com.webmethods.caf.faces.component.table.SelectRowCheckbox.ChildCheckbox
- All Implemented Interfaces:
ISelectRow
,EventListener
,PartialStateHolder
,StateHolder
,TransientStateHolder
,ComponentSystemEventListener
,FacesListener
,SystemEventListenerHolder
- Enclosing class:
- SelectRowCheckbox
-
Nested Class Summary
Nested classes/interfaces inherited from class com.webmethods.caf.faces.component.table.SelectRow
SelectRow.SelectionActionListener
-
Field Summary
Fields inherited from class com.webmethods.caf.faces.component.table.SelectRowIndividualCheckbox
TYPE
Fields inherited from class com.webmethods.caf.faces.component.table.SelectRow
FAMILY, m_submittedSelectedIds, m_submittedUseUnselected
Fields inherited from class javax.faces.component.UIComponent
ATTRS_WITH_DECLARED_DEFAULT_VALUES, BEANINFO_KEY, bindings, COMPOSITE_COMPONENT_TYPE_KEY, COMPOSITE_FACET_NAME, CURRENT_COMPONENT, CURRENT_COMPOSITE_COMPONENT, FACETS_KEY, HONOR_CURRENT_COMPONENT_ATTRIBUTES_PARAM_NAME, VIEW_LOCATION_KEY
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ionAccesskey for control.getClientId
(FacesContext context) getId()
protected SelectRowCheckbox
Tabindex for control.boolean
True if row cannot be selected.boolean
True if allows multiple rows to be selected.Methods inherited from class com.webmethods.caf.faces.component.table.SelectRow
applySubmittedValues, getData, getFamily, getFor, getSubmittedSelectedIds, getSubmittedUseUnselected, restoreState, setAccesskey, setDisabled, setFor, setMultiple, setSubmittedSelectedIds, setSubmittedUseUnselected, setTabindex
Methods inherited from class com.webmethods.caf.faces.component.BaseComponent
getAttributes, getPropertyOrBindingValue, saveState, setBindingValue
Methods inherited from class javax.faces.component.UIComponentBase
addClientBehavior, addFacesListener, broadcast, clearInitialState, decode, encodeBegin, encodeChildren, encodeEnd, findComponent, getChildCount, getChildren, getClientBehaviors, getDefaultEventName, getEventNames, getFacesContext, getFacesListeners, getFacet, getFacetCount, getFacets, getFacetsAndChildren, getListenersForEventClass, getParent, getPassThroughAttributes, getRenderer, getRendererType, getRendersChildren, getValueBinding, invokeOnComponent, isRendered, isTransient, markInitialState, processDecodes, processRestoreState, processSaveState, processUpdates, processValidators, queueEvent, removeFacesListener, restoreAttachedState, saveAttachedState, setId, setParent, setRendered, setRendererType, setTransient, setValueBinding, subscribeToEvent, unsubscribeFromEvent
Methods inherited from class javax.faces.component.UIComponent
encodeAll, getClientId, getCompositeComponentParent, getContainerClientId, getCurrentComponent, getCurrentCompositeComponent, getNamingContainer, getPassThroughAttributes, getResourceBundleMap, getStateHelper, getStateHelper, getTransientStateHelper, getTransientStateHelper, getValueExpression, initialStateMarked, isCompositeComponent, isInView, isVisitable, popComponentFromEL, processEvent, pushComponentToEL, restoreTransientState, saveTransientState, setInView, setValueExpression, visitTree
-
Constructor Details
-
ChildCheckbox
public ChildCheckbox()
-
-
Method Details
-
getId
- Overrides:
getId
in classUIComponentBase
-
getClientId
- Overrides:
getClientId
in classUIComponentBase
-
getAccesskey
Description copied from interface:ISelectRow
Accesskey for control.- Specified by:
getAccesskey
in interfaceISelectRow
- Overrides:
getAccesskey
in classSelectRow
-
isDisabled
public boolean isDisabled()Description copied from interface:ISelectRow
True if row cannot be selected.- Specified by:
isDisabled
in interfaceISelectRow
- Overrides:
isDisabled
in classSelectRow
-
isMultiple
public boolean isMultiple()Description copied from interface:ISelectRow
True if allows multiple rows to be selected.- Specified by:
isMultiple
in interfaceISelectRow
- Overrides:
isMultiple
in classSelectRow
-
getTabindex
Description copied from interface:ISelectRow
Tabindex for control.- Specified by:
getTabindex
in interfaceISelectRow
- Overrides:
getTabindex
in classSelectRow
-
getParentCheckbox
-